Output 895a12d06f426524f1ebb2e86e73b4da1fff126fa2b6b0a5441e1753676b2df7:0
- value
- 73104133
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 14d89e5f16f43e2af0ec42f046a77431c67f826d OP_EQUAL
- address
- 33bEwJmkS8bWH83AZBf8q2vTjLqAkAsJ6Z
- transaction
- 895a12d06f426524f1ebb2e86e73b4da1fff126fa2b6b0a5441e1753676b2df7
- confirmations
- 651
- spent
- true